I'm announcing the release of the 2.6.27.33 kernel. It fixes a build
error with the ocfs2 filesystem. If you do not use ocfs2, there is no
need to upgrade to this version, and 2.6.27.32 is sufficient.
I'll also be replying to this message with a copy of the patch between
2.6.27.32 and 2.6.27.33
